Understanding Plastic Durability

Plastic durability refers to the material’s ability to withstand stress, impact, and environmental factors without breaking or degrading. Different types of plastics offer varying levels of durability, making it crucial to choose the right one for your needs.

  • Impact Resistance: This is the ability of plastic to absorb energy and resist sudden forces without cracking or breaking.
  • Environmental Resistance: Some plastics can withstand UV light, moisture, and temperature changes better than others.

Common Types of Durable Plastics

Several plastics are known for their durability and impact resistance. Here are some of the most commonly used types:

  1. Polycarbonate (PC):
  2. Extremely strong and impact-resistant.
  3. Often used in safety glasses and protective gear.
  4. Lightweight and has excellent optical clarity.

  5. Acrylic (PMMA):

  6. Offers high impact resistance and is more shatter-resistant than glass.
  7. Used in applications like signage and displays.
  8. UV resistant, making it suitable for outdoor use.

  9. Polypropylene (PP):

  10. Known for its flexibility and resistance to fatigue.
  11. Commonly used in automotive parts and consumer products.
  12. Good chemical resistance makes it ideal for containers.

  13. Polyethylene (PE):

  14. Available in various densities, each offering unique properties.
  15. Low-density polyethylene (LDPE) is flexible and used for bags, while high-density polyethylene (HDPE) is more rigid and used for bottles and containers.

  16. Nylon (PA):

  17. Known for its strength and abrasion resistance.
  18. Used in textiles, gears, and bearings.
  19. Can absorb moisture, which may impact its durability in certain applications.

Benefits of Using Durable Plastics

Choosing durable plastics can provide several advantages:

  • Longevity: Durable plastics last longer, reducing the need for frequent replacements.
  • Cost-Effectiveness: While the initial investment may be higher, the long-term savings from reduced maintenance and replacement costs can be significant.
  • Versatility: Durable plastics can be molded into various shapes and sizes, making them suitable for a wide range of applications.
  • Safety: Impact-resistant plastics can enhance safety in products, such as eyewear and protective gear.

Challenges of Plastic Durability

While durable plastics offer numerous benefits, there are some challenges to consider:

  • Environmental Impact: Many plastics are not biodegradable and can contribute to pollution if not disposed of properly.
  • Temperature Sensitivity: Some plastics can become brittle at low temperatures or deform at high temperatures.
  • Chemical Resistance: Not all plastics resist chemicals equally, so it’s essential to choose the right type for specific applications.

What is the most durable type of plastic?
The most durable type of plastic is often considered to be polycarbonate, known for its exceptional impact resistance and strength.

Are all plastics impact-resistant?
No, not all plastics are impact-resistant. The level of impact resistance varies significantly among different types of plastics.

How do I maintain the durability of plastic products?
To maintain durability, keep plastic products clean, avoid exposing them to extreme temperatures, and store them properly when not in use.

Can durable plastics be recycled?
Many durable plastics can be recycled, but it depends on the type of plastic and local recycling capabilities. Always check local guidelines.

What are some common applications for impact-resistant plastics?
Common applications include safety goggles, automotive components, signage, and protective equipment. Their versatility allows for use in various industries.
